Well, all the tests were worth it!!!!
I have had an additional 56% decrease in my tumor markers since January!!! I started out with them at 711.1 this past October (35 is normal) and by November they were down to 516.2, in December they were down to 389.3 and in January they were down to 250.9. Right now, they are down to 106.9!!!! On the way to remission. I am beyond ecstatic! It has been amazing watching those numbers drop!
Now, onto all the scan results! All looked good, nothing new and the cancer in the bone is all healing! Hopefully by this summer I will be NED (No Existing Disease). We are headed there now!
I started a new chemo yesterday. Instead of Taxol, we went with Abraxane (it is still a taxane like Taxol). I will be on it for 3 weeks on, 1 week off, so every 4th week I will have a break. I will still have 12 infusions of this. So far, so fine on this! My counts were down quite a bit, but they were still able to start this chemo yesterday. I did have a slight problem with my blood pressure. Not sure what was up with that, but it kept dropping. It went down to 84/54, so they had to monitor that all through chemo. But, they just made sure I felt ok and was able to leave afterwards, thank God! We had a flight home booked for that evening and I would not have wanted to have to miss it.
